linux文件内容搜索关键字怎么操作
问题描述:linux文件内容搜索关键字怎么操作
推荐答案 本回答由问问达人推荐
grep是Linux中一个强大的文本搜索工具,它可用于查找文件内容中包含特定关键字的行。以下是如何使用grep进行文件内容搜索的基本语法和示例:
基本语法:
bashgrep [选项] "关键字" 文件名
示例用法:
基本搜索:在文件example.txt中搜索包含关键字"search"的行。
bashgrep "search" example.txt
忽略大小写:搜索时忽略大小写,这将匹配关键字"Search"和"search"。
bashgrep -i "search" example.txt
显示行号:显示匹配行的行号。
bashgrep -n "search" example.txt
正则表达式搜索:使用正则表达式搜索,例如,查找以"abc"开头的行。
bashgrep "^abc" example.txt
递归搜索目录:在目录中递归搜索包含关键字"search"的文件。
bashgrep -r "search" /path/to/directory
统计匹配数量:统计匹配的行数。
bashgrep -c "search" example.txt
使用grep可以帮助您快速查找包含特定关键字的文件内容或文本行。这是一个强大且广泛使用的命令行工具,适用于各种文本搜索任务。
查看其它两个剩余回答